  2. I converted a game from the Spectrum Quill to Atari by simply listing all the instructions and re-entering them into AdventureWriter. Boring and extremely time consuming! As has been said the fact that the Spectrum had around 8k more of space to play with is a problem when converting adventures. I ran out of memory when trying to convert an Atlantis tape release called 'Marie Celeste' (http://www.worldofspectrum.org/infoseekid.cgi?id=0006656) and it was hardly Level 9 or Infocom quality. I'd be interested to see anything that comes from converting these adventures over to the Atari. Maybe it'd be best to take a look at some of the earlier Quilled efforts like 'The Adventures of Barsak the Dwarf' (http://www.worldofspectrum.org/infoseekid.cgi?id=0005927) as they may not have utilised the full memory like later efforts surely would.
